Extra Info:
This is todays[17092020] high spring tide of 33feet rising from a low tide of 6ft.
this happens twice a day throughout the 24 hour period and this was the highest in the period allowed in competition and I had good weather in a sunrise coming from LH side
spring tide happens for a few days each month and the highest is due on saturday night

SteveBee
Sep 18, 2020
Impressive tides! From a technical standpoint a few issues with the image. There's something cutting into the frame in the upper left corner. The image is extremely noisy such that the sky is gritty looking. Your camera settings are rather unusual for a sunrise shot. The high ISO 800 and an extremely short 1/2000s exposure time lead to noise. The short exposure limits the light reaching the sensor. The high ISO then amplifies the noise.
